I have used Art Impression T3094 (Sir Stampalot) as my main image stamped in versafine black and embossed with detail clear. To incorporate the hearts I used a Stamps by Judith (Stamp Addicts) stubby stamp to decorate her dress, colouring the hearts with the cocoa and the cornflower blue for the main part of her dress. As I have said before, I have problems with solitary figures, so my little girl is walking across cobbles stamped with Art Impression L3297, has some chalked clouds above her and some little birds using part of Art Impression G3234. My DP's are Daisy Bucket and Doodlebug, the top panel was run through the bug using the hearts folder to carry the theme and finished off with three flowers and some swarovski crystals.

The card I am sharing today is using a JudiKins bolio stamp........these boilo stamps are such good value as you get four sides, so four totally different stamps and they are so easy to use. I have stamped the image twice with versamark onto a lightly glimmer misted background of gold and embossed with green and ruby sparkle powder. I then cut the images into small squares and matted onto green cardstock. The DP is from The Paper Company and the scallop border is using Fiskars threading water punch.

This weeks Everybody Art Challenges is a sketch from Tina. I have used a new stamp from Magenta 41017K stamped in versafine sepia and embossed with detail clear onto a background created by sponging sunflower, citrus and pumpkin Stayzon onto glossy cardstock, then spritzing with Tim Holtz blending solution which makes the colours bleed. My DP is Daisy Bucket and the scalloped strip has been created by stamping an unmounted border stamp (sorry no idea of origin) onto the offcut from my main image ...... I was once accused of overstamping this one, but the dots and lines are all part of the stamps rustic look ! Circles were cut with nesties on the bug and some brown dots added to finish.

Penny Black challenge
My image is Penny Black 3633K stamped with versafine black and embossed with detail clear. The flowers have been filled in with red sticklers and mounted white onto white pearlescent card. The greeting down the side has been created with punched circles and flowers from the same DP and stamped with a set of letters which I'm afraid I do not have a source name for. Red ribbon, a ladybird which I thought just matched, a button and a corner cut from Cricut Jasmine which I heat embossed with iridescent powder.

Allsorts challenge week 8
My card is using the very pretty template from Cricut Wild Card. My DP's are Doodlebug and the butterfly image is JudiKins 2696K - Cloth Butterfly which I stamped onto vellum three times and cut out to obtain the graduated wings. I coloured the back of the vellum with Marvy pens, layerd it up with silicone, addded stickles and pearls for the throax and wire for the antenna. Cirles were all cut on the Cuttlebug using nesties.

Stamping for the Weekend
I stamped my main image - Hobby Arts FL1824G using versafine black and detail clear embossing powder and coloured in with my new Promarkers ........ well after buying all 92 got to get my use out of them and more importantly get the technique right ........ lots of practice required here still me thinks.
DP is from Scrappy Cat and top border cut with MS embossed scallop. The green buds are cut from Cricut Storybook, inked with Brilliance thyme and embossed with detail clear. Flowers have been done exactly the same but using Brilliance orchid and a touch of crimson, although the look very pinky in the photo they aren't that bright in reality, it's probably the reflection because they are embossed and shiny. I have also used the crimson to stamp the greeting which is a tiny section of one of the circle greetings from Woodware FRCL128.
